Jaguar9080 Posted March 30, 2015 Share Posted March 30, 2015 Yeah, the "music player" in the Amplifi Remote is just using the native Music app. So if you have repeat set on the native Music app, it's mirrored in Amplifi Remote. That's also why, if you're playing songs using the Music app, the playback is stopped when you open the Amplifi app. I find it quite annoying, because the "music player" in Amplifi Remote is poorly implemented. It's full of bugs in the display (sometimes playlist titles show as a solid white bar among other problems) and sometimes when you click on a song to play it won't actually start the song. It just goes back to the last song that was played, without actually starting playback. I also find it annoying that I have to wait for the Remote app to search for tones before I can skip or restart a song. Even when I have the automatic tone loading turned off.
